KATA
Literally translated, kata means “shape which cuts the ground.”
A kata is an imaginary fight with a sequence of blocks, kicks and punches from one or more stances. It involves forward, backward and side movements. The balance between offensive and defensive techniques, the stances used and the direction and flow of movement all serve to give each kata its distinctive character.
